summaryrefslogtreecommitdiffstats
path: root/src/com/android/launcher3/dragndrop
diff options
context:
space:
mode:
authorTony Wickham <twickham@google.com>2017-03-30 23:26:12 +0000
committerandroid-build-merger <android-build-merger@google.com>2017-03-30 23:26:12 +0000
commit52f0130a76addcfec25775004c24346dc69b30d3 (patch)
tree480a0ea0971ea74f46227625507693aceb06a943 /src/com/android/launcher3/dragndrop
parent65caaf60cec88db83e2c2626a9fd8cce12842928 (diff)
parentd73fbb5f975ceedaec6463164ee39b3f32623151 (diff)
downloadandroid_packages_apps_Trebuchet-52f0130a76addcfec25775004c24346dc69b30d3.tar.gz
android_packages_apps_Trebuchet-52f0130a76addcfec25775004c24346dc69b30d3.tar.bz2
android_packages_apps_Trebuchet-52f0130a76addcfec25775004c24346dc69b30d3.zip
Merge "Add WidgetsAndMore bottom sheet" into ub-launcher3-dorval
am: d73fbb5f97 Change-Id: I5d1bad3ea83e672076dbd3b6f2d80d5149f3921c
Diffstat (limited to 'src/com/android/launcher3/dragndrop')
-rw-r--r--src/com/android/launcher3/dragndrop/DragLayer.java7
1 files changed, 7 insertions, 0 deletions
diff --git a/src/com/android/launcher3/dragndrop/DragLayer.java b/src/com/android/launcher3/dragndrop/DragLayer.java
index e1a983486..705262e5b 100644
--- a/src/com/android/launcher3/dragndrop/DragLayer.java
+++ b/src/com/android/launcher3/dragndrop/DragLayer.java
@@ -60,6 +60,7 @@ import com.android.launcher3.keyboard.ViewGroupFocusHelper;
import com.android.launcher3.logging.LoggerUtils;
import com.android.launcher3.util.Thunk;
import com.android.launcher3.util.TouchController;
+import com.android.launcher3.widget.WidgetsAndMore;
import java.util.ArrayList;
@@ -245,6 +246,12 @@ public class DragLayer extends InsettableFrameLayout {
return true;
}
+ WidgetsAndMore widgetsAndMore = WidgetsAndMore.getOpen(mLauncher);
+ if (widgetsAndMore != null && widgetsAndMore.onControllerInterceptTouchEvent(ev)) {
+ mActiveController = widgetsAndMore;
+ return true;
+ }
+
if (mPinchListener != null && mPinchListener.onControllerInterceptTouchEvent(ev)) {
// Stop listening for scrolling etc. (onTouchEvent() handles the rest of the pinch.)
mActiveController = mPinchListener;